Mr. President, I rise in support of S. 140, as amended, the bill sponsored by the outstanding Senator from the great State of Kansas, Mr. Moran. This bill affirms Tribal sovereignty and upholds the unique government-to-government relationship the United States shares with the Indian nations. As chairman of the Indian Affairs Committee, I have long said there is far more common ground than division on Indian issues. Our committee has a strong tradition of working in a bipartisan manner to improve the lives of Indian people and to build stronger Native American communities. With the support of Indian Country, we have successfully advanced important initiatives to support Tribal economic development, healthcare, public safety, and housing. Additionally, we have worked to support our many Native veterans. Native Americans proudly serve and defend our great country at some of the highest rates per capita of any ethnic group. Of the 29 bills we have cleared through the Indian Affairs Committee this Congress, 18 have passed the Senate by unanimous consent and 4 have already been signed into law.…
